Georg...Degelow was the commander of KL Dachau's SS-Totenkopfwachsturmbanne in 1944-45. His previous assignments:

SS-Totenkopfstandarte 15 -1940-41
SS-Ersatz Btl "Westland" 1941-43 (Company Commander)
SS-PzG AuE Btl 5 1 1943
II SS Panzer Korps 1943
VI SS Panzer Korps 1943-44

His name appears in the July 1944 Waffen SS DAL
Fritz Degelow SS Nr 176978 Born 25.2.1892 Promoted HSF der Reserve 9.11.40 promoted SBf der Reserve 30.1.45 and he was transferred to KL Dienst January 1945.

Degelow, Fritz
SS-Stubaf.

Born - 25 Feb 92
SS- 178 978

Not mentioned in Dec 1938 DAL
SS-Hstuf d. Res 9 Nov 40
SS-Hstuf. as Chef,3./E.Btl."Westland in Dec 41
SS-Hstuf. with II Pz Korps in Jul 43
SS-Hstuf. with VI-SS-Frw.Armee Korps in Feb 44
SS-Stubaf promoted 30 Jan 45
SS-Stubaf. KL Dachau in Jan 45

Degelow was from 15.11. – 12.12.1945 defendant in the Dachau-Trial (Case No. 000-50-2: US v. Martin Gottfried Weiss et al). He was sentenced to death but the judgement was reduced to 20 years of imprisonment later.
